For a certain type of investor, real estate is a satisfying option. If you’re looking for reasons to begin investing in the real estate market, we’ll outline the major advantages here.

Real Estate Investing Benefits

  • Stability: Real estate investing can provide a less volatile investment opportunity than the stock market. 
  • Active management opportunities: RE investment can be a good option for investors that enjoy an active, hands-on role. If you’d rather work on your own investment growth strategy and don’t care for investment accounts managed by others, real estate investment could be for you. 
  • Investing options: Some investors have done well with residential and/or commercial real estate development, while others prefer owning multiple rental properties. In rentals, you could concentrate on single-family homes or multi-family properties, or a combination. Some investors get into real estate investing via house-flipping.  
  • Diversification: Investing in rentals can diversify your portfolio while also bringing reliable income. (Keep in mind there are no guarantees of steady income or profits from any type of investment.) 
  • Costs are incremental: You can profit from real estate investment while you are paying for it. You don’t need to wait until you own it outright to make money. 
  • Profit from economies of scale: For example, in multi-family rental investing, you can add properties to your portfolio with a relatively small additional cost to you. You can spread the cost of property management over multiple properties. 
  • Delegate daily management with minimal cost to you: You can afford a property manager to handle details like collecting rents, screening or evicting tenants, coordinating repairs, and more. Once you have a few properties in your real estate investment portfolio, the cost of the manager won’t significantly cut into your profits–since you typically pay a small percentage of rents “per door”–but it will save you valuable time.
